KAURI TIMBER COMPANY.

f AN IMPROVED OUTLOOK. 4 United Press Association —By Electric u Telegraph—Copyright. r SYDNEY, December 15. £. • At a meeting of the Kauri Timber Company the chairman stated that the abnormal season in New Zealand had ci interfered with, the company’s opera'Z. tions, and caused a diminution in the re ■ profits, otherwise the sales were prac■T, tically the’same in quantity, and only 6- per cent less in value, as compared ‘V with last year’s, business. The timber trade throughout Australia had been ?. very depressed, but since the company’s year closed a decided improvement had occurred, and the improved outlook, coupled with the fact that there was still £15,000 of undivided profit left, warranted the recommendation of the payment of. the same divi■■h dend as last year.
